đź”” FCM Loaded

Application Engineer II

Swiss Re

2 - 5 years

Bengaluru

Posted: 05/08/2025

Job Description

Location: Bangalore, KA, IN

About the Role

The role of a Software Engineer at Swiss Re is one of the key roles in our journey to become a truly service and software driven company. It is your main goal to grow and maintain .NET based business applications. You interact with the Business users using your applications.

About the Team

Our team is the global P&C Reinsurance Technology team, responsible for the engineering of IT solutions for the reinsurance business unit. The team members are passionate of bringing business needs and technology together. We closely collaborate with other teams and colleagues around the globe to share knowledge and engineer solutions.

Your Responsibilities Include

  • Design and develop code for our Microsoft technology-based business solutions using .NET VSTO for Applications (Excel, Access).
  • Responsibility of the architecture, design, and implementation details of software applications and components

Make sure technical and design standards are followed by the development teams

  • Design and maintain robust, high-performance REST APIs utilizing .NET Core, ensuring scalability, security, and optimal performance.
  • Manage and develop our Microsoft technology-based tools and databases.
  • Identify and collect pain points in applications; discuss it with team and bring it forward to P&C architecture team.

About You

Are you passionate about .NET software development and technology? Are you eager to support business and serve as a value adding force to create an impact? Are you also open to learning other technologies such as Cloud, Java, or Python?

You Should Bring the Following Skills & Experiences

  • Proficiency in .NETVBA, and Microsoft technologies, with hands-on experience in PowerShellOffice Interop, and COM Interop for desktop application development.
  • Strong experience in .NET Core / .NET 5+ for building scalable REST APIs, including use of Entity Framework CoreOpenAPI/Swagger, API versioning, and security protocols such as JWT and OAuth2.
  • Solid background in designing and maintaining SQL databases, including PostgreSQL and SQL Server.
  • Familiarity with Azure DevOpsCI/CD pipelines, and Git for version control and automated deployments.
  • Experience working in an agile software development environment, particularly using Scrum methodologies.
  • Experience in modern software architecture using synchronous, asynchronous integration technologies using RabbitMQ, Azure Service Bus, or Kafka, and other technologies
  • Exposure to Java technologies is a plus.
  • Knowledge of public cloud platforms such as AzureAWS, or Google Cloud is a plus.

About Swiss Re

Swiss Re is one of the world’s leading providers of reinsurance, insurance and other forms of insurance-based risk transfer, working to make the world more resilient. We anticipate and manage a wide variety of risks, from natural catastrophes and climate change to cybercrime. We cover both Property & Casualty and Life & Health. Combining experience with creative thinking and cutting-edge expertise, we create new opportunities and solutions for our clients. This is possible thanks to the collaboration of more than 14,000 employees across the world.

Our success depends on our ability to build an inclusive culture encouraging fresh perspectives and innovative thinking. We embrace a workplace where everyone has equal opportunities to thrive and develop professionally regardless of their age, gender, race, ethnicity, gender identity and/or expression, sexual orientation, physical or mental ability, skillset, thought or other characteristics. In our inclusive and flexible environment everyone can bring their authentic selves to work and their passion for sustainability.

If you are an experienced professional returning to the workforce after a career break, we encourage you to apply for open positions that match your skills and experience.

Keywords:  
Reference Code: 134822 

About Company

Swiss Re (Swiss Reinsurance Company Ltd) is one of the world’s leading providers of reinsurance, insurance, and other forms of risk transfer. Headquartered in Zurich, Switzerland, the company was founded in 1863 and operates globally. Swiss Re helps insurance companies manage their risks by offering financial protection against large-scale losses, such as those from natural disasters, pandemics, or economic crises. It plays a crucial role in stabilizing the insurance market and supporting sustainable growth through expert risk assessment and innovative solutions.

Services you might be interested in

One-Shot Campaign

Reach out to ideal employees in one shot!

The intelligent campaign for reaching out to the ideal audience to whom you can ask for help (guidance or referral).